Our church is starting a new branch in our area. They're holding services, for now, in the high school. We wanted to say "thank you" to the teachers who have graciously allowed us to use their classrooms.
Today's project is nothing new or exciting for you seasoned stampers, however, I thought you might like to see another use for the JustRite StampersSmall letter kit.
When I first got mine, my first thought was, "You've got to be kidding!"....the letters are so tiny and my eyes are so old! The tweezers should have been a dead giveaway, right? Was I surprised!!!
The kit is ULTRA easy to use. The beauty of it is that you can say literally anything you want to say. I didn't know the individual teacher's names so I used the initials of the school. (just click on the photo for a close up)
I had only a couple of hours to think first of what to make, (that's always the hard part for me) for 11 people and then to actually do the creating. I wanted a close approximation of the school colors but was limited to my stock on hand. Additionally, the gift had to work for both men and women...there went all my bling! Everyone loves chocolate, or knows someone who does, so I decided to wrap those giant Cadbury bars. I like the silver paper on them.
This paper by American Arts was a deal at Big Lots...$2 for an entire package of 24...all the same pattern but for $2, I figured I'd find a use for it, right? LOL! The reverse side is solid blue and because I didn't have a ribbon to match, I just made a "belly band". The circles are all cut with my Spellbinders circle dies and Cuttlebug. I popped the center circle up on dimensionals. I recommend using Scor-Tape to make sure the wrapper stays put.
We placed these on packages of printer paper. We hope they liked it.
